What Exactly Is a Real-Money Gambling Platform and How Does It Work?

A real-money gambling platform is a digital environment where users wager actual currency on casino games like slots, blackjack, or roulette, with the potential to withdraw winnings. It functions as a centralized operator, managing both deposits and payouts. Users first fund their account via payment methods such as credit cards or e-wallets, converting fiat into platform credit. They then place bets; each wager’s outcome is determined by a Random Number Generator (RNG) to ensure unpredictability. Wins are credited to the account balance, which can be withdrawn as real cash, while losses are deducted. The platform acts as the banker, with a built-in house edge ensuring its profitability over time, but individual users may win or lose in the short term.

Understanding house edge and volatility before you play

Before engaging with any real-cash online casino, you must understand that the house edge is a fixed mathematical advantage ensuring the casino profits over time, typically ranging from 0.5% on blackjack to over 10% on certain slots. Volatility, or variance, dictates how often and how large your payouts occur—low volatility yields frequent small wins, while high volatility risks long dry spells for a shot at a massive jackpot. Aligning your bankroll with a game’s volatility and accepting its house edge is critical for sustained play. Choosing games with lower house edge and matching volatility to your risk tolerance directly extends your session and improves your odds. Question: How do house edge and volatility affect my bankroll? Answer: The house edge slowly erodes your funds over time, while volatility determines the speed and size of your bankroll swings; high volatility can empty your balance quickly if you haven’t budgeted for its dry periods.

How quickly can you cash out your winnings?

Withdrawal speeds for real-money casino payouts vary directly by payment method. E-wallets like PayPal or Skrill typically process within 24 hours, while credit cards and bank transfers can take 3–7 business days. The casino’s internal “pending time”—often 24–48 hours for identity verification—is the primary bottleneck. Faster cash-outs require having your account fully verified before requesting.

  • E-wallets: 12–24 hours after casino approval.
  • Cryptocurrencies: often instant or within 1 hour.
  • Bank transfers and cards: 3–7 business days.
  • Pending periods can add 24–72 hours depending on withdrawal amount.

What happens if you encounter technical issues during a game?

Most reputable real-money online casinos use systems to track game data, so if you encounter technical issues during a game, the round is often voided and your stake refunded. You must immediately screenshot the error screen and contact support with your username and timestamp. Disconnection during a live dealer game typically means bets are settled based on the final outcome as seen by the dealer, though policies vary. Avoid closing the app or refreshing, as this can erase temporary session logs that support needs to investigate. The casino’s terms of service will outline specific time limits for reporting such issues.

Q: What happens to my active bet if the server crashes during a game?
Most casinos will refund the bet if the crash prevents the round from completing, but if the outcome was already generated server-side, the result stands.
